chain stitch machineHistorically, sewing machines were limited to lightweight materials and delicate fabrics. However, as the demand for stronger packaging increased, the technology behind sewing machines adapted accordingly. Woven sack bag sewing machines have evolved to handle thicker, heavier materials, ensuring robust seam integrity capable of withstanding the rigors of transport and storage.

Coverstitch chain stitching is predominantly used in the finishing process of hems, especially on knit fabrics. It is commonly found on t-shirts, leggings, jerseys, and activewear due to its ability to stretch and recover. However, its applications go beyond hems. The coverstitch can also be used for attaching bindings, reinforcing seams, or as a decorative feature on the surface of garments, making it a multifaceted addition to any sewing toolkit.

A heavy-duty upholstery sewing machine is designed to handle thick, heavy fabrics such as canvas, denim, leather, and upholstery materials. Unlike standard sewing machines, which may struggle or even break when faced with multiple layers of heavy fabric, heavy-duty machines are equipped with robust motors and specialized features that allow them to sew through these challenging materials with ease. They often come with powerful needle systems and a strong feed mechanism to ensure consistent stitching.

Heavy-duty mechanical sewing machines are built with robust materials and components. They often feature a metal frame that provides stability and reduces vibrations during operation, ensuring precise stitches. The heavy-duty presser foot is another key element; it exerts more pressure on the fabric, allowing for smooth feeding of multiple layers and thicker materials without skipping stitches. These machines typically come with a range of stitch options, including straight stitch, zigzag, and specialized stitches like bar tacks, which are frequently needed in heavy sewing projects.

In addition to its strength, double needle saddle stitch also offers a clean and professional look. The parallel lines created by the two needles running side by side give the stitch a neat and uniform appearance. This makes it a popular choice for high-end leather goods and custom-made books where aesthetics are important.

Reinforced concrete has long been a cornerstone in civil engineering, valued for its remarkable compressive strength, versatility, and durability. Traditional steel reinforcement bars (rebar) have been the standard for enhancing concrete's tensile properties. However, Fiber Reinforced Polymer (FRP) bars have emerged as a viable alternative, promising superior performance in specific environments and applications. The mechanics and design of reinforced concrete with FRP bars is a burgeoning field that offers exciting possibilities for modern construction.

Square water storage tanks are characterized by their geometric shape, typically featuring four equal sides. This design allows for optimal use of space, making them ideal for locations with limited ground area. The construction of these tanks can be made from various materials, including reinforced concrete, fiberglass, plastic, and steel. The choice of material often depends on the intended use, environmental conditions, and budget.
